Soaps Ratings Roundup: April 30
EastEnders took the lead in the soaps ratings yesterday, attracting just under 8 million viewers.

Thursday's instalment of the Walford-based serial, which saw Heather attend the hospital and discover an anomaly in her test results, was watched by 7.8m (39.5%) at 7.30pm.

BBC Three's repeat at 10pm added a further 817k (4.7%).

Emmerdale's outing at 7pm, during which a suspicious Natasha confronted her husband Mark about his recent dubious behaviour, attracted 6.06m (32.6%).

Doctors' penultimate episode of the week, titled 'Lost and Found', drew 1.8m (24.1%) in its usual 1.45pm slot.

Mark's raid on The Loft during last night's Hollyoaks interested 1.43m (8%), while E4's first look offering took 514k (3.1%). E4+1's repeat transmission added 148k (0.8%).

Meanwhile, Five's edition of Neighbours, during which Miranda finally admitted the truth to Bridget, logged 1.44m (10.8%) at its traditional time of 5.30pm, before Fiver's 7pm repeat added 354k (2.1%).

Home and Away's screening at 6pm, which featured Ruby rumbling Charlie and Joey's relationship, managed 1.04m (6.4%). Fiver's first look 30 minutes later had 619k (3.9%).

Ratings data supplied by Attentional
